Warning: file_get_contents(/data/phpspider/zhask/data//catemap/8/meteor/3.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
使用Joose和Meteor_Meteor_Joose - Fatal编程技术网

使用Joose和Meteor

使用Joose和Meteor,meteor,joose,Meteor,Joose,使用Joose和Meteor(或Meteorite)的最佳方式是什么 我只有在加载Joose-all.min.js时才能让Joose工作,但这似乎不允许我使用其他Joose库(特别是JoosX属性) 我还尝试创建一个包,该包的package.js文件中包含 Npm.depends({ 'joose' : '3.50.0' }); 但这只会导致meteor无法从以下错误开始 /home/dev/GDL/gdl-csr/meteor/.meteor/local/build/server/s

使用Joose和Meteor(或Meteorite)的最佳方式是什么

我只有在加载Joose-all.min.js时才能让Joose工作,但这似乎不允许我使用其他Joose库(特别是JoosX属性)

我还尝试创建一个包,该包的package.js文件中包含

Npm.depends({
    'joose' : '3.50.0'
});
但这只会导致meteor无法从以下错误开始

/home/dev/GDL/gdl-csr/meteor/.meteor/local/build/server/server.js:337 
}).run();
     ^ ReferenceError: Joose is not defined
    at app/gdl-csr.js:1:16
    at /home/dev/GDL/gdl-csr/meteor/.meteor/local/build/server/server.js:298:12
    at Array.forEach (native)
    at Function._.each._.forEach (/home/dev/.meteor/tools/cc18dfef9e/lib/node_modules/underscore/underscore.js:78:11)
    at run (/home/dev/GDL/gdl-csr/meteor/.meteor/local/build/server/server.js:239:7)
=> Exited with code: 1
=> Your application is crashing. Waiting for file change.

meteor变量中有什么建议可以让我继续吗?

的作用域是它们的特定文件。因此,您需要公开Joose。您必须在其中一个lib文件中使用

Joose = Npm.require('joose');
相对于

var Joose = Npm.require('joose');

在meteor中,变量的作用域是其特定的文件。因此,您需要公开Joose。您必须在其中一个lib文件中使用

Joose = Npm.require('joose');
相对于

var Joose = Npm.require('joose');

知道为什么不需要使用var吗?我认为所有变量(在现代javascript中)都应该声明。您可以使用
var
,但是该变量的作用域将在该文件的本地,即您不能在该文件之外访问它。没有它,它仍然是一个变量声明,但它可以在任何文件中访问。你知道为什么不需要使用var吗?我认为所有变量(在现代javascript中)都应该声明。您可以使用
var
,但是该变量的作用域将在该文件的本地,即您不能在该文件之外访问它。如果没有它,它仍然是一个变量声明,但可以在任何文件中访问它